#4cf300 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4cf300 is composed of 29.8% red, 95.3%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 4.7% black. It has a hue angle of 101.2 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 47.6%. #4cf300 color hex could be obtained by blending #98ff00 with #00e700. Closest websafe color is: #33ff00.

#4cf300 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4cf300 has RGB values of R:76, G:243,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.69, M:0, Y:1,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 5042944.

Shades and Tints of #4cf300
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020800 is the darkest color, while #f7fff3 is the lightest one.
